What are the best practices for securing my cryptocurrency wallet?

I want to ensure the security of my cryptocurrency wallet. What are the best practices I should follow to protect my digital assets from potential threats?

- Burce Ivan Josh EOct 22, 2025 · a month agoWhen it comes to securing your cryptocurrency wallet, there are several best practices you should keep in mind. Firstly, make sure to choose a reputable wallet provider that has a strong track record of security. Look for wallets that offer features like two-factor authentication and multi-signature functionality, as these can add an extra layer of protection to your funds. Additionally, it's important to keep your wallet software and operating system up to date with the latest security patches. Regularly backing up your wallet and storing the backup in a secure location is also crucial. Finally, be cautious of phishing attempts and never share your wallet's private keys or recovery phrases with anyone. By following these best practices, you can significantly reduce the risk of your cryptocurrency wallet being compromised.
- GauravB007Sep 04, 2020 · 5 years agoSecuring your cryptocurrency wallet is of utmost importance in order to protect your digital assets. One of the best practices is to use a hardware wallet, which is a physical device specifically designed for storing cryptocurrencies. Hardware wallets offer enhanced security by keeping your private keys offline and away from potential online threats. Another important practice is to enable two-factor authentication (2FA) on your wallet accounts. This adds an extra layer of security by requiring a second form of verification, such as a code generated by an app on your smartphone. Additionally, it's crucial to regularly update your wallet software and use strong, unique passwords for your accounts. Lastly, be cautious of phishing attempts and only download wallet software from official sources.
